How to Build the Best Compshop

Shop Layout Fundamentals

Your shop layout directly affects how many customers use your PCs simultaneously and how quickly they cycle through stations. A well-designed Compshop maximizes income per square foot while looking appealing enough to attract visitors from the server list.

The best layouts balance function and aesthetics. Prioritize function early in beta — pretty shops with poor PC placement earn less than compact, efficient setups.

PC Station Placement

Place PC stations in a grid or row formation where customers can easily access every slot. Avoid blocking pathways between stations. Leave space for future expansion rather than packing stations into corners.

Put your highest-tier PCs in the most visible positions. Customers gravitate toward impressive setups, and visible legendary rigs advertise your shop to visitors. Reference our PC parts guide for tier priorities.

Decoration Strategy

Decorations serve two purposes: increasing shop appeal rating and creating a welcoming atmosphere that keeps customers longer. Focus on decorations that provide measurable bonuses rather than purely cosmetic items.

See our decorations page for category breakdowns. A good rule: spend no more than 20% of your budget on decorations until all PC slots are filled with mid-tier or better parts.

Food and Service Areas

Food stations keep customers at your shop longer, increasing total payment per visit. Place food areas near PC clusters so customers can grab snacks without leaving. The new food items added in recent beta updates provide both income and customer satisfaction bonuses.

Browse our foods guide for item recommendations. Even basic food options provide a measurable boost over shops without any food service.

Expansion Planning

Expand your shop floor gradually. Each expansion tier costs cash but unlocks more PC slots and decoration space. Time expansions with x2 Cash events when you can afford them without draining your upgrade budget.

Plan your final layout before expanding — moving stations after expansion wastes time. Sketch a simple grid on paper: entrance, PC rows, food corner, decoration walls.

Visiting and Learning from Top Shops

The support and favorite system lets you visit other players' Compshops. Study layouts from high-ranked shops on your server. Note their PC arrangement, decoration density, and food placement.

Adapt ideas to your budget rather than copying expensive setups. A clean, organized small shop often outperforms a cluttered large one in the early and mid game.

FAQ

What is the best shop layout in Compshop?
A grid of PC stations with clear pathways, food nearby, and decorations along walls for appeal bonuses.
Should I expand my shop early?
Expand only when all current PC slots have decent parts installed. Empty expanded space earns nothing.
Do decorations affect customer count?
Yes. Higher shop appeal from decorations attracts more visitors.
